Understanding Licensing and Regulation

One of the primary distinctions between UK-licensed casinos and non-UK casino sites lies in the regulatory bodies overseeing their operations. UK casinos are stringently regulated by the UK Gambling Commission (UKGC), an organization renowned for its robust standards and player protection measures. Conversely, non-UK casinos typically operate under the licenses of other jurisdictions, such as Curacao, Malta Gaming Authority (MGA), Gibraltar, or Kahnawake. While these licensing bodies are legitimate, their regulatory frameworks may differ in stringency compared to the UKGC.

It’s important to understand that a license doesn't automatically guarantee a flawless experience. Even casinos licensed by reputable authorities can have shortcomings. Researching the specifics of the licensing jurisdiction is therefore critical. For instance, the MGA is generally considered a highly respected regulator, while a Curacao license, while valid, often indicates a less rigorous oversight process. Players should always verify the validity of a casino’s license by checking the regulator’s official website and looking for any reported issues or sanctions. A legitimate license number should always be displayed prominently on the casino's website, usually in the footer.

Licensing Authority Level of Regulation (General) Common Characteristics
UK Gambling Commission (UKGC) Very High Strict player protection, extensive audits, high tax rates.
Malta Gaming Authority (MGA) High Reputable, well-established, comprehensive regulatory framework.
Gibraltar Regulatory Authority High Similar to MGA, strong reputation and oversight.
Curacao eGaming Moderate Lower tax rates, faster licensing process, potentially less rigorous oversight.

Beyond the license itself, examine the casino's terms and conditions carefully. These documents outline the rules governing gameplay, bonuses, withdrawals, and dispute resolution procedures. Transparent and fair terms are a hallmark of a trustworthy operator. Beware of casinos with overly complex or ambiguous terms that could be used to disadvantage players. Investigating independent review sites and forums can also provide valuable insight into the experiences of other players, revealing any potential red flags or positive attributes.

Security Measures Employed by Non-UK Casinos

Security is paramount when engaging with any online casino, and non-UK sites are no exception. Reputable operators employ a range of advanced security measures to protect player data and financial transactions. The most fundamental of these is SSL (Secure Socket Layer) encryption. This technology creates an encrypted connection between your device and the casino’s server, preventing unauthorized access to sensitive information such as credit card details and personal data. Look for the padlock icon in your browser’s address bar, which indicates a secure connection.

Beyond SSL encryption, robust firewalls, intrusion detection systems, and regular security audits are essential components of a secure online casino environment. These measures help to prevent unauthorized access, data breaches, and other cyber threats. Furthermore, many casinos utilize two-factor authentication (2FA), requiring players to verify their identity through a second method, such as a code sent to their mobile device, adding an extra layer of protection. Responsible casinos will also have stringent policies regarding data storage and handling, complying with relevant data protection regulations.

The Role of Random Number Generators (RNGs)

A critical aspect of fairness and security in online casinos is the use of Random Number Generators (RNGs). These algorithms ensure that the outcomes of games, such as slots and table games, are truly random and unpredictable. Reputable casinos utilize RNGs that have been independently tested and certified by accredited testing agencies, such as eCOGRA or iTech Labs. These agencies verify that the RNGs are functioning correctly and producing unbiased results. Avoid casinos that cannot provide evidence of independent RNG certification as this suggests a potential risk of manipulation.

The absence of independent verification makes the outcome of games suspect, and it could be the sign of an unreliable casino. Players should always check for RNG certification prior to making any deposits. The certification report usually confirms the payout percentages and the fairness of the casino’s games.

  • SSL Encryption: Protects data transmission.
  • Firewalls: Prevent unauthorized access to servers.
  • Two-Factor Authentication (2FA): Adds an extra layer of security to login.
  • Independent RNG Certification: Ensures game fairness and randomness.
  • Secure Payment Gateways: Protect financial transactions.

Secure payment gateways are also crucial. Casinos should offer a variety of trusted payment methods, such as credit/debit cards, e-wallets (e.g., PayPal, Skrill, Neteller), and cryptocurrencies, all secured by encryption protocols. They should also have clearly defined policies regarding withdrawals and processing times. It's important to remember that while casinos employ security measures, players also have a responsibility to protect their own accounts by using strong, unique passwords and avoiding phishing scams.

Payment Options and Withdrawal Procedures

The availability of convenient and secure payment options is a significant consideration for players choosing non-UK casino sites. While many offshore casinos accept traditional payment methods like credit and debit cards, they often offer a wider range of alternatives, including e-wallets and cryptocurrencies. E-wallets provide an additional layer of security by masking your banking details from the casino, while cryptocurrencies offer increased anonymity and potentially faster transaction times.

However, it's important to be aware that cryptocurrency transactions are often irreversible, so caution is advised. Furthermore, some jurisdictions have specific regulations regarding cryptocurrency gambling, so it’s crucial to understand the legal implications in your region. Withdrawal procedures can vary significantly between casinos. Some casinos may impose limits on withdrawal amounts, while others may require verification of your identity before processing a withdrawal. Always check the casino’s terms and conditions regarding withdrawal limits, processing times, and any associated fees. A reliable casino will have a transparent and efficient withdrawal process.

  1. Review Withdrawal Limits: Carefully check the casino's maximum withdrawal amounts.
  2. Identity Verification: Be prepared to provide documentation for account verification.
  3. Processing Times: Understand the estimated time it takes for withdrawals to be processed.
  4. Fees: Inquire about any withdrawal fees that may apply.
  5. Payment Method Restrictions: Confirm that your preferred payment method is eligible for withdrawals.

Beware of casinos that delay withdrawals without providing a valid explanation or impose unreasonable fees. A legitimate casino will strive to process withdrawals promptly and efficiently, fostering trust and transparency with its players. Prioritizing casinos with a strong track record of reliable payments is essential for a positive gaming experience.

Customer Support and Dispute Resolution

Effective customer support is a critical aspect of any online casino, particularly for non-UK casino sites where players may encounter language barriers or time zone differences. Reputable operators offer multiple support channels, such as live chat, email, and phone support, with well-trained and responsive agents available to assist with any queries or issues. Live chat is often the most convenient option for quick assistance, while email support is suitable for more complex inquiries.

It’s crucial to assess the quality of customer support before depositing funds. Test the support channels by asking a few questions to gauge the responsiveness, knowledge, and helpfulness of the agents. A casino that provides prompt, professional, and courteous support is a positive sign. Furthermore, it’s important to understand the casino’s dispute resolution process. In the event of a disagreement, a clear and fair dispute resolution mechanism is essential. Look for casinos that are affiliated with independent dispute resolution services, such as AskGamblers or the Casino Complaints Resolver.

Navigating the Legal Landscape and Responsible Gambling

The legal status of non-UK casino sites can be complex, varying depending on your location. It’s crucial to understand the gambling laws in your jurisdiction before engaging with any offshore casino. Some countries may prohibit online gambling altogether, while others may require players to obtain a license or adhere to specific regulations. It's your responsibility to ensure that you are complying with the laws in your region. Furthermore, responsible gambling should always be a top priority. Set limits on your deposits, losses, and playing time, and never gamble with money you cannot afford to lose.

Many casinos offer tools to help you manage your gambling habits, such as deposit limits, self-exclusion options, and reality checks. Utilize these tools to promote responsible gaming and protect yourself from potential harm. Recognizing the signs of problem gambling and seeking help when needed are also crucial steps. Resources like GamCare and BeGambleAware provide valuable support and guidance for individuals struggling with gambling addiction. Remember that gambling should be a form of entertainment, not a source of financial stress or emotional distress. Players should always approach non-UK casino sites with a realistic mindset, fully aware of the risks and adhering to responsible gambling practices.
